Denver Computer Recycling and Disposal

The Girl Scouts certainly do a lot of good for Denver and we’re not just talking about the cookies (although those are very good!). As part of their continuing community outreach, Girl Scout Troop 2879 from Aurora recently held an e-waste recycling event at three downtown Denver locations. For these events the Girl Scouts partnered up with Metech Recycling who handled the bulk of the end game for the recycling. They promised that all personal date left behind on computers or laptops would be wiped out and up to 95% of all the e-waste collected would be recycling not incinerated or dumped into a landfill. That’s a pretty good goal to aim for.

Like most of these sponsored events there was a dumping charge for the privilege of getting rid of your e-waste. Here the Girl Scouts charged $10 for small TVs and computer monitors, $15 for TVs with screens larger than 20 inches, and $1 for laptops, printers, fax machine, VCRs, keyboards and other small electronics.

You can’t begrudge the Girl Scouts for taking this opportunity to fundraise. However, if you didn’t have the opportunity to make the drop off you would still be stuck with all your old computer gear. Alternatives to Denver Dumpster Rentals

Are you taking on a DIY remodel project? Good for you. It’s a terrific way to increase the value of your home and show off all those skills you learned on home improvement shows. But as you focus on the particulars of the project you’ll also have to think about what that project is going to be creating in huge piles. That would be construction waste. A solution that many people turn to is renting a dumpster. What could go wrong? Actually a lot.

First of all, you have to consider where this dumpster is going to be dumped. The average heavy metal containers are about 22 feet long and eight feet deep. That unit also needs to be “planted” on a hard flat surface. “Flat” being the key word there. If your driveway has any kind of slope to it you could be in trouble. Even if you think you’ll be able to brace the dumpster, once it started to get loaded up that weight can shift and you’ve got the potential for a wrong away dumpster. Not a good idea.

Renting a dumpster doesn’t give you free reign to dump anything. The dumpster rental company will still be charged with getting rid of your trash and they could be fined if they’re dumping any kind of hazardous material. This means batteries, paints and anything with harmful chemicals like an AC unit can’t be thrown out in the rented dumpster.

Then there is the volume issue. You will probably be restricted to filling up your dumpster only to ¾ of the capacity. This is because the rental company will need to close the lid in order to transport that dumpster. What happens if you have more trash than what fits in your dumpster? Will your dumpster have to be taken away, emptied and brought back? Doesn’t that defeat the purpose of renting the dumpster in the first place?

That issue of capacity is important because if you rent the wrong size dumpster then you’ll be in trouble. One thing to consider is that you might think you’ll only have a certain amount of garbage but once your neighbors see that dumpster, they’re going to think its open season as far as getting rid of trash it concerned. Many folks have discovered that an empty dumpster dropped off in the afternoon is full to the brim with other people’s trash by the next morning.

Denver Foreclosure Clean Out

There is good news to be found in a recent report out of the Colorado real estate market. According to the Colorado Division of Housing the number of foreclosure filings were down by 1% for the first four months of 2012. That translates to foreclosures falling from 8,476 at this time last year to 8,395. Foreclosure auction sales were also down by a whopping 29% during the same time. Clearly this is an indication that the Colorado real estate market is on the mend but that doesn’t mean it is out of the woods yet. There are still plenty of signs around the Denver area that show foreclosures are still prevalent. Denver Old TV Disposal

Have you ever taken apart a television? Probably not. But if you had you would’ve discovered all kinds of pieces and wires that could be recycled. Back in the early days of television, a TV was made up of glass tubes. This wasn’t just the monitor bubble butt the components that made up the electronic system of the TV. Now all of those components have been replaced by the same type of motherboards find in your computer. All of these components are considered electronic waste and need to be properly disposed of. Disassembling the television could take anywhere from 10 to 20 minutes. This all kinds of hazardous materials that can be released when a television is just out into a landfill. In fact there could be as much as 6 pounds of lead in an old TV set. That’s not something you want seeping into the water supply around Denver.

Over at the Denver Waste Management facility they collect all kinds of electronic waste. By some estimates 80% of what they get are TVs and computer monitors. Even a television as old as 20 years can be turned into reusable items at the right recycling center. Individuals who drop off their electronic waste might have to pay a special fee because of the necessary handling. But it’s a small price to pay when it comes to protecting the environment.

Denver Refrigerator Disposal & Buying Tips

How old is your refrigerator? If you have to think about the answer to that question then it really might be time to take the plunge and buy a new refrigerator. Many Denver residents are extremely environmentally conscious when it comes to purchasing goods. While it is true that it uses up a lot of energy and resources to make a refrigerator it could be that your old model is actually using up more energy than it would take to build a new refrigerator.

The older your refrigerator the more likely it is to be a bigger drain on energy resources. This is why the Environmental Protection Agency developed the Energy Star program in the first place. Energy Star is a program that is overseen by the EPA and the Department of Energy. These two agencies have created a set of standards that encourages manufacturers to improve the design of their devices. In exchange for that these companies are rewarded with tax credits and other benefits. For the consumer they can buy with confidence knowing that an appliance with the energy star label is going to help reduce their monthly electric bills.

One way to think about this is that if your refrigerator was manufactured in the 1990s you’re probably paying at least $100 more a year to keep that fridge cool than you would with a more modern version.

Next to the energy savings you might be getting with your new refrigerator you also want to consider your available kitchen space. Just because the refrigerator the store looks like there same size as the one in your kitchen doesn’t mean it will be. You really don’t want to get into a situation where you have a new refrigerator delivered that can’t fit into your cabinet space. Measure the dimensions of your current fridge at least twice before heading out to shopping.

Once you have those dimensions written down you’ll have the opportunity to pick through a variety of different refrigerator models. There are side-by-side, top freezer or bottom freezer refrigerator models. Each of these designs offers up their own individual benefits. A bottom freezer design is perfect for someone who doesn’t use their freezer a lot and would rather have most of their food items at eye level.

You’ll also have the opportunity to upgrade your “refrigerator experience” by adding special features such as movable shelves that also slide in and out, built-in ice makers and water dispensers and temperature control bins. On some models there are even plasma television screens built right into the refrigerator door.

Denver Hot Tub Purchase & Disposal Tips

During the winter, Denver is a popular town. You’ve probably already experienced how eager friends and family are to show up to take advantage of the great skiing and other winter outdoor fun. Entertaining guests is always a lot of fun and that fun can be enhanced when you invite those folks into a hot tub. It might seem strange to your visitors to ask them to trudge across the snow to get into a hot tub but once inside those inviting waters there won’t be any complaints. If you don’t have a hot tub in your backyard you’re missing out on a lot of pleasure. Perhaps there’s an old hot tub left over from the previous owner that hasn’t been used for years. Instead of it becoming a huge birdbath why not consider getting rid of that hot tub and replacing it with the new model?

Shopping for a hot tub is not unlike shopping for a new bed: comfort is key. As you visit hot tub showrooms you’ll have the opportunity to actually crawl into a hot tub albeit one without water. While you might feel ridiculous sitting in an empty hot tub fully clothed it’s really the best way to assess how comfortable you’ll be once this town is installed in your own backyard. Forget feeling silly! You want to make sure you’ve got room to float in.

Another important factor in shopping for a new hot tub is the level of hydrotherapy performance you might be getting from your new tub. This will come in the form of jet placement. Once again you just can’t beat getting into the hot tub to see where these soothing jets of bubbles will be massaging your body from. You should also check out how easy it is to make adjustments with these jets. Many new hot tubs are remote control which is perfect for Denver winter. You can literally turn on the hot tub, heat up the water and get those jets going all from the inside of your home. The moment you see steam rising off the hot tub you know it’s ready!

Your new hot tub should also be easy to take care of. It could be that the old hot tub sitting in your backyard was too cumbersome to keep up which is why it was left to ruin. A new premium hot tub will have a circulation pump that will continuously filter the water and provide the necessary flow for the heater to set the desired temperature.
